Abstract
The utility model discloses a drunken driving preventing system which is arranged in an automobile. The drunken driving preventing system comprises an alcohol detector, a single chip microcomputer, a displayer, a GPS module, a voice calling system and an alarm, wherein the single chip microcomputer is respectively connected with the alcohol detector, the displayer, the GPS module and the alarm, and the voice calling system is connected with the GPS module. The drunken driving preventing system can achieve the control over drunken driving fundamentally, has the advantages of being high in performance cost ratio, high in intelligence degree and stable and reliable in working, and has good popularization value in actual application.

Background technology
The harm of driving when intoxicated is self-evident, because drinking, can have a strong impact on driving behavior, increases the probability that traffic accident occurs in driving procedure.It can make the reduction of steerman haptic capabilities, judgement and operator perforniance reduce, produce dysopia, produce mental handicape and fatiguability etc.Therefore a large amount of traffic accidents that cause have brought serious harm to people's lives and properties, and administering drives when intoxicated becomes one of emphasis in road traffic accident prevention work.The statistics of traffic accidents data that provide according to Public Security Department of the Ministry of Public Security, the traffic violation of driving when intoxicated causes 1.09 ten thousand of traffic accidents every year on average over nearly 5 years, causing that 4054 people are dead, 1.16 ten thousand people are injured, is one of major incentive causing traffic injuries and deaths accident.By seeing the comparative analysis of drive when intoxicated over nearly 5 years traffic accident number of times, the casualties, average every the traffic accident of driving when intoxicated causes that 0.37 people is dead, 1.06 people are injured, approximately every 3 accidents just to have 1 people's fatal accident order of severity to occupy all kinds of traffic accidents the first.
The painful accident of driving when intoxicated reminds people must strengthen technological applications, strengthens the research and development application that prevents the system of driving when intoxicated, and further applies equipment and system that alcohol user drives.At present, on market, police alcohol tester is of a great variety, powerful, highly sensitive, but because it is not arranged on automotive interior, can only be implemented by traffic police personnel, therefore can not fundamentally stop to drive when intoxicated, and the event of driving when intoxicated still happens occasionally.

The specific embodiment
Below in conjunction with accompanying drawing, the utility model drinking prevention drive system is elaborated.
As shown in Figure 1, the utility model drinking prevention drive system is located in automobile, comprises alcohol-detection instrument, micro controller system, telltale, GPS module, voice calling system, power module, Keyboard Control module, control relay, indicator lamp and annunciator.That alcohol-detection instrument can be provided with is a plurality of (can be arranged on respectively on the crown of main driving parking stall, on bearing circle, the limit of car door first-class), comprises alcohol sensor, signal condition amplifying circuit and filter circuit.Alcohol sensor is connected with micro controller system by signal condition amplifying circuit, filter circuit successively.Wherein, alcohol sensor adopts side heating semiconductor-type alcohol gas-sensitive element MQ3, and micro controller system adopts Atmega16 micro controller system.Micro controller system is connected with annunciator with telltale, GPS module, control relay, power module, indicator lamp respectively.Keyboard Control module is connected with alcohol-detection instrument.Voice calling system is connected with GPS module.Wherein, telltale adopts SED1335 Graphic lattice LCD module; Annunciator adopts buzzer phone.Control relay is connected with the firing circuit of automobile.
Micro controller system adopts High Performance of new generation that Liao You atmel corp develops, low-power consumption, highly integrated 8-bit microprocessor, has advanced risc architecture, and the execution time of most of instructions is single clock period enhancement mode ATMEGA16 micro controller system.Its operating voltage 4.5-5.5V, frequency of operation 0-16MHZ, supports jtag port emulation and programming, simulated effect is more authentic and valid than traditional simulation.Its integrated fault rate that not only greatly reduces of height, and all having a clear superiority in aspect cost, volume, stability.
When micro controller system works in idle pulley, CPU quits work, and USART, two line interfaces, A/D conv, SRAM, T/C, SPI port and interrupt system work on; Crystal oscillator failure of oscillations during power-down mode, all functions all quit work except interruption and hardware reset; Under battery saving mode, nonsynchronous timer continues operation, allow user to keep a time reference, and all the other functional modules is in dormant state; During ADC noise suppression pattern, stop CPU and the work of all I/O modules except nonsynchronous timer and ADC, the switching noise when reducing ADC conversion; Under Standby pattern, only have crystal or resonant oscillator operation, all the other functional modules, in dormant state, make device only consume few electric current, have quick startup ability simultaneously; The expansion next permission oscillator of Standby pattern and nonsynchronous timer work on.
It is directly micro controller system power supply that power module adopts the 5V that LM2576 series switch integrated regulator produces, the another distribution such as alcohol-detection instrument source.
Alcohol-detection instrument adopts side heating semiconductor-type alcohol gas-sensitive element MQ3, and investigative range is 10~1000ppm.Alcohol-detection instrument built-in 12 ADC etc. in high precision alcohol sensor MQ3, signal condition amplifying circuit, filter circuit and micro controller system form, and radical function is to detect alcohol content, judges whether it exceeds standard.Signal condition amplifying circuit adopts integrated operational amplifier LF347 and integrated analog switch CD4066 is connected into automatic zero set amplifying circuit.This amplifying circuit is combined the input offset voltage grade of wide region and low maladjustment voltage drift, high input impedance, extremely low power consumption and high gain, and very high offset voltage stability is provided.By the configuration of peripheral circuit, can realize the signal amplification that reaches 30 times of left and right, meet the signal that sensor is sent completely and amplify, be convenient to the A/D data acquisition of ATmega16 micro controller system.
Indicator lamp comprises red greenish-yellow three indicator lamps, and red light is power light, bright during work; Green light is to detect warning light, because alcohol probe needs certain hour heating, just can reach desirable sensitivity, and time of heat arrives, green light, and expression can be carried out concentration detection; Amber light is warning indicator lamp, and amber light does not work, and expression can be driven a vehicle; When amber light is bright, represent that alcohol concentration exceeds standard, cannot drive, the frequency of amber light flicker is simultaneously higher, and alcohol concentration is higher.
What telltale was selected is the SED1335 Graphic lattice LCD module of Guangzhou Science and Technology Ltd. of Easthome, this is the dot matrix graphic LCD of a low-power consumption, can be operated in the situation of 3.3V power supply, display format is 128(row) * 64(is capable), there is multifunction instructions, inside, with Chinese word library, not only can work in serial mode but also can work in parallel mode, is easy to be connected with the micro controller system of 16.In native system, adopt concurrent working pattern with being connected of micro controller system, the input port that the asynchronous serial communication end USART of liquid crystal display control single chip computer chip ATmegal6 of take is external data or control command.
The utility model has adopted GPS module as development platform, when alcohol detection system, sends drunk exceeding standard during signal, and this module will be dealt into the information of site on voice calling system.In at ordinary times without drunk (drinking) situation, this module is just served as GPS real time route guidance system, for chaufeur is submitted necessary information.This GPS module communicates by asynchronous serial communication mode and micro controller system, only needs connection two signal wire (SW) TXD, RXD and ground wire can carry out data transmission on hardware connects.Serial communication adopts higher communication voltage ± 5~± 15V, normal employings ± 10V and ± 12V, and be negative logic level, logical zero level regulation is+5~+ 15V, logical one level stipulates to be-15~-5V, standard serial.Process level conversion between mouth and TTL/CMOS level;
Control relay is control system, and its output loop is by control system.Control relay can play control action; to input certain signal in its control system; when physical quantitys such as electricity, magnetic, heat, light reaches certain value; can make to be suddenlyd change to certain value by zero by the controlled variable of control system (claiming again output loop); or by certain value, suddenlyd change to zero, thereby reach the effects such as control, protection, transmission and transitional information.With the large electric current of Small current control, it is exactly the feature of control relay.This control relay is controlled by single-chip processor i/o mouth, is equivalent to switch, and break-make, the break-make of car temperature control circuit by Control firing circuit, safety strap tightens up and unclamp etc.
The output loop of control relay is point of connection ignition circuit and car temperature control circuit respectively, can realize firing circuit and the break-make to car temperature control circuit.As shown in Figure 4, control to safety strap degree of tightness, by control relay, according to alcohol content data, control position sensor is by being located at the position (being position shown in 1 in P3,2,3 in Fig. 4) of inner variable resistance regulating relay switch, the position that regulates safety strap to tighten up.
As shown in Figure 3, control relay is controlled the break-make of this car temperature control circuit.Variation with temperature, the resistance meeting respective change of thermally dependent resistor, the critical temperature of setup control is t0, temperature t >t0 in car, RT declines, A point potential rise, due to VT1, VT2 composite amplifier saturation conduction, make B point current potential lower than the trigger level 1/3VDD=4V of 555 2 pin, 555 are set, mouth 3 pin are high level, VT3 conducting, motor M obtains electric, running cooling, RT is because of cooling subsequently, it is large that resistance becomes, A point current potential declines, make VT1, VT2 is in critical conduction mode, B point current potential is during higher than 555 6 pin threshold level 2/3VDD=8V, circuit reset, 3 pin transfer low level to, VT3 cut-off, motor stalling, so go round and begin again, reached the object of controlling and maintaining vehicle interior temperature.
As shown in Figure 5, in voice calling system, adopted ISD1100 speech chip, continue alcohol detection circuit, send and exceed standard after signal, this system reads the information that GPS module sends and by voice calling system, alcohol user site information is passed to its nearest contact person, allow him come to help, as: " I am now in XX orientation, and I have been drunk, please be fast next ".Utilize buzzer phone as annunciator, when alcohol content exceeds standard, send and forbid the warning tones of driving a vehicle; While not exceeding standard, send and allow driving prompt tone.I/O mouth by micro controller system drives buzzer phone to realize.
As shown in Figure 6, Figure 7, the keyboard circuit of Keyboard Control module adopts independent keyboard, adopts the mode of interrupting to work, and can set the system parameter of alcohol-detection instrument, such as the alcohol concentration of the warning of setting etc.
In conjunction with Fig. 2, utilize Keyboard Control module to carry out system parameter setting to alcohol-detection instrument.When driver opens car door, alcohol-detection instrument starts, and now driving engine is in by lock status, and automobile cannot start.After alcohol sensor heating, gas signal is detected, the signal detecting is after amplification and filtering, and 12 ADCs built-in by micro controller system are converted to digital signal, have micro controller system to process judgement to this signal.If alcohol content does not exceed standard, the current alcohol concentration of the upper demonstration of LCD, green indicating lamp lights simultaneously, control relay is inoperative, and automobile starts thereupon, and this drinking prevention drive system is in low power consumpting state, micro controller system, in Standby pattern, only has alcohol-detection instrument to work always.If alcohol content exceeds standard, LCD is upper except showing current alcohol concentration, shows the mobile captions note of how to relieve the effect of alcohol rapidly simultaneously, and yellow indicator lamp lights, and annunciator is reported to the police simultaneously, control relay point of cutoff ignition circuit, and safety strap tightens up simultaneously.
Voice calling system starts, and by GPS module, is measured current location and is told to programmed emergency with voice or note " I am now in * * orientation, and I have been drunk, please be fast next ", and now chaufeur cannot start automobile, fundamentally realizes the control to driving when intoxicated.And to programmed emergency, can set a plurality ofly, when first call number is after 1 minute during access failure, system can be automatically brought to calls out next contact person, by that analogy.
